Quantum annealing systems represent a specialized approach to quantum computing that focuses on addressing computational optimisation challenges via quantum mechanical procedures. These get more info advanced equipments operate by discovering the most affordable power state of a quantum system, which corresponds to the optimal remedy for specific computational difficulties. Research centers across Europe and past have actually started incorporating quantum annealing modern technology right into their computational infrastructure, recognising its capacity for advancement findings. Establishments are seeking to house advanced quantum systems consisting of the D-Wave Two release, which serves as a keystone for quantum research study campaigns. These installations enable scientists to check out complicated problems in materials science, logistics optimisation, artificial intelligence, and monetary modelling. The quantum annealing procedure leverages quantum tunnelling and superposition to browse solution landscapes much more successfully than classical formulas, specifically for combinatorial optimisation challenges that would need exponential time on typical computer systems.

The integration of quantum computer into existing computational process presents both opportunities and challenges for research establishments and innovation business. Hybrid quantum-classical algorithms are becoming a sensible technique to utilize quantum benefits whilst preserving compatibility with well established computational infrastructure. These hybrid systems permit scientists to use quantum cpus for specific computational tasks whilst relying upon classical computers like ASUS Chromebook launch for information preprocessing, evaluation of outcomes and overall administration of operations. The development of quantum programming languages and software application kits has actually enhanced the process of creating quantum algorithms, making quantum computer available to scientists without substantial quantum physics backgrounds. Error modification and sound mitigation continue to be considerable obstacles in useful quantum computing applications, calling for advanced techniques to guarantee reputable computational results.

Research study centers worldwide are establishing devoted quantum computing infrastructure to support advanced scientific investigations and technical advancement. These specialized centres require significant in both equipment and knowledge, as quantum systems require specific environmental controls, including ultra-low temperatures and electro-magnetic securing. The functional complexity of quantum computers like the IBM Quantum System Two release necessitates interdisciplinary collaboration between physicists, computer researchers, and domain name specialists from different areas. Universities and national research laboratories are developing partnerships to share quantum sources and develop collective research study programs that maximise the capacity of these expensive systems. The establishment of quantum facilities additionally includes considerable training programmes for trainees and scientists, ensuring the next generation of researchers can effectively use these effective devices. Accessibility to quantum computing capabilities via cloud platforms and shared centers democratises quantum study, enabling smaller organizations to participate in quantum computing experiments without the costs of preserving their very own systems.
